Lesson Content:
Step 1: Meaning of Chemical Reactions
-
A chemical reaction is a process in which one or more substances (reactants) are changed into new substances (products) with different properties.
-
It involves the breaking and forming of chemical bonds.
Step 2: Signs of a Chemical Reaction
- Change in color
- Evolution of gas
- Formation of a precipitate
- Change in temperature (heat absorbed or released)
- Change in odor or production of light
Step 3: Types of Chemical Reactions
- Combination (or Synthesis) Reaction
- Two or more substances combine to form a single product.
- General form: A + B → AB
- Example:
2Mg + O_2 → 2MgO
- Decomposition Reaction
- A single compound breaks down into two or more simpler substances.
- General form: AB → A + B
- Example:
2H_2O_2 → 2H_2O + O_2
- Displacement (or Substitution) Reaction
- A more reactive element replaces a less reactive one in a compound.
- General form: A + BC → AC + B
- Example:
Zn + CuSO_4 → ZnSO_4 + Cu
- Double Displacement (or Metathesis) Reaction (Optional extension)
- Two compounds exchange ions to form two new compounds.
- General form: AB + CD → AD + CB
- Example:
NaCl + AgNO_3 → NaNO_3 + AgCl↓
Step 4: Differences Between Physical and Chemical Changes
Physical Change |
Chemical Change |
No new substance is formed |
New substances are formed |
Usually reversible |
Usually irreversible |
Examples: melting, boiling |
Examples: rusting, combustion |
